A video clip shows an old lecture Ustaz Abdul Somad (UAS) who forbade his congregation to mention Sunday.

One of the netizens who shared the UAS video was the owner of the Twitter account @rosela_setia. He uploaded it on Monday (30/5/2022).

In the video, Ustaz Abdul Somad is seen lecturing on the pulpit and explaining the meaning of the word Sunday.

According to UAS, Sunday comes from the word Dominggo which means a day to worship the Lord Jesus Christ.

"Don't mention Sunday," said UAS, quoted by Populis.id from the tweet of the @rosela_setia account, Tuesday (31/5/2022).

He added, “Sunday is taken from the word Dominggo. Dominggo means the day of worshiping God. Lord God Jesus Christ."

After that, a woman was heard responding to UAS. However, the sound is identical to that of Google.

The woman then said that UAS was too fanatical blindly.

"Dear Ustaz Somad, I'm sorry because I thought you were a blind fanatic," said a typical Google female voice.

He himself admits that the word Sunday does have something to do with Jesus Christ, the God that Christians believe in.

However, he questioned whether the faith of Muslims would be affected just because they mentioned Sunday.

He said, "It must be admitted that the name Sunday has something to do with Jesus Christ who Christians believe as God."

“But will your faith and the faith of your followers be affected by just mentioning the name of Sunday? How weak and fragile is your faith?” he asked emphatically.

When uploading the video clip of the UAS lecture, the account owner @rosela_setia poked fun at a number of other figures such as Refly Harun, Fadli Zon, to Said Didu.
